Practice CW (Morse Code) on your mobile or tablet device using the straight or iambic key simulator of CW Studio. Ideal for Ham Radio and people interested in amateur radio or morse code. Use for training or just for fun with friends.

CW Studio offers keyers designed with real details, bringing a great experience without no additional equipment required for training. Only by touching screen the app will play sound and decode what is handled.

Features:

- Choose the type of keyer (straight or iambic).
- Handle with tone and speed that you prefer.
- Visualize and listen the character table in the ITU-R standard.
- Train to receive morse code reception, in which the app sends sounds of different letters or symbols and you indicate the correct answer.
- Use the player feature to listen to and save the morse code audio of typed texts.
- Train or listen morse code in background while you use other apps or with your phone screen off (PRO).
- Use morse code decoder to decode sounds captured in your microphone (PRO).
